Kan
Yuk sa Chapter, National Society Daughters of the
American Revolution,
is located in Jacksonville, FL.
We were organized on October 17,
1950 by 11 of the 14 organizing members.
The name is the Seminole Indian
name for Florida. "Kan" means "land or ground" and
"Yuk sa" means "point of".
We are the only night
chapter in Jacksonville resulting in many of our members being working
women.
